> Gour, thanks for putting up a release candidate! Two important things with
> respect to release logistics: the release should be staged at
> https://dist.apache.org/repos/dist/dev/incubator/slider/
> <http://dist.apache.org/repos/dist/dev/incubator> rather than
> https://dist.apache.org/repos/dist/release/incubator/slider/
> <https://dist.apache.org/repos/dist/release/incubator/slider/0.92.0-incuba
> ting-RC0>
> <https://dist.apache.org/repos/dist/release/incubator/slider/0.92.0-incuba
> ting-RC0>
> ... the "release" path means that the staged candidate is being
> distributed
> to all the mirrors. Maybe it would be possible to svn mv the
> 0.92.0-incubating-RC0 directory to the dev path? Also, please append your
> key to the KEYS file at
> https://dist.apache.org/repos/dist/release/incubator/slider/KEYS. There
> are
> instructions at the top of the file.
